vue_计算属性

vue 计算属性(原有属性经过计算得到)

computed

计算属性有缓存机制

第一次获取属性值会调用getter 方法,属性值会被缓存,下次获取属性值时不会调用getter方法,当该计算属性所关联的数据发生改变,再获取属性值 会调用getter 方法,缓存新的值。




    
    Title


计算属性_反转字符串

反转字符串:{{reverse}}

vue_计算属性_第1张图片

修改文本框中的内容,下面的内容也会随之变化

修改文本框的内容,因为 v-model="msg" 指令 使data中的 msg 的值发生改变,

计算属性  reverse 关联 msg,当msg的值发生改变,调用reverse 的get方法重新获取属性值

vue_计算属性_第2张图片 

 

简写形式(没有set方法,只有get方法)




    
    Title


计算属性_反转字符串

反转字符串:{{reverse}}

你可能感兴趣的:(vue.js,前端,javascript)